The Math Basis Underlying Every Fall

The platform demonstrates the Galton mechanism concept, where items moving through numerous branch nodes create a Gaussian probability curve. All peg contact represents a dual decision—left side or right—with roughly 50% probability for both direction. Using 16 rows, there are 65,536 potential paths (65,536 possibilities), yet the majority of routes concentrate to middle positions, forming the characteristic bell graph of conclusions.

RTP to Player (payout) rates in our game remain consistent throughout separate releases but become more predictable over many of rounds. Temporary sessions can differ substantially from anticipated outcomes, which explains why some users experience outstanding profit runs while different players encounter frustrating setbacks regardless of identical methods.

Essential Mathematical Concepts

  1. Projected Worth: Calculate probable returns by computing each multiplier by its chance and summing results
  2. Normal Deviation: Greater danger settings increase variance, producing greater extreme outcomes both favorable and negative
  3. Rule of Large Quantities: Over prolonged session rounds, observed outcomes move towards theoretical mathematical expectations
  4. Independent Events: Each fall has null relation to earlier results, making trend-based forecasts statistically unsound
  5. Verifiable Transparency: Secure seeds allow confirmation that outcomes had not been manipulated after wager submission
